How do I install Volume Control on Windows?⌄
Open Windows Terminal, PowerShell, or Command Prompt and run: winget install --id radj307.volume-control --exact --version 6.6.3. winget downloads the installer from radj307 and runs it. Requires Windows 10 (1809+) or Windows 11.
How do I install Volume Control silently for unattended deployment?⌄
Add --silent and accept the agreements upfront: winget install --id radj307.volume-control --exact 6.6.3 --silent --accept-package-agreements --accept-source-agreements. This is the variant Intune, Configuration Manager, and other deployment tools should use.
How do I uninstall Volume Control via winget?⌄
Run: winget uninstall --id radj307.volume-control --exact. Add --silent for unattended uninstalls. winget will use the registered uninstaller from Volume Control's Apps & Features entry.

Does Volume Control work on Windows 10?⌄
Yes, as long as your Windows 10 build supports winget (1809 or newer). winget ships with App Installer on Windows 10/11 and pulls Volume Control directly from the publisher.
How do I keep Volume Control up to date?⌄
Run winget upgrade --id radj307.volume-control --exact, or winget upgrade --all to update everything winget tracks. We index 10 versions of Volume Control from microsoft/winget-pkgs.
